Creative Possibilities: Ableton Live is known for its innovative approach to music creation and performance. Live 12.3.2 continues this tradition, offering an extensive range of creative possibilities. The software’s unique session and arrangement views provide users with flexibility during the composition, arrangement, and mixing phases. The session view serves as a playground for building ideas and experimenting with loops and samples, while the arrangement view allows for refining and structuring compositions. These features make Ableton Live an ideal tool for both jamming and producing polished tracks. Live Performance Features: Ableton Live’s reputation as a fantastic tool for live performances remains intact in the 12.3.2 version. With the introduction of Capture MIDI, users can retrospectively capture their improvised ideas without the need to hit the record button. Additionally, MIDI mapping allows for integration with various external controllers, enabling artists to manipulate their music in real-time during live performances. These features make Ableton Live a go-to choice for electronic musicians and DJs seeking flexibility on stage.
